This has probably been already reported/discussed, but maybe not. It's just
a minor annoyance, but when rendering part of an animation, the frame count
is not very consistent.
For example, with command:
povray test.pov +KFF35 +KC +SF25
the rendering starts with:
Processing Frame 25 of 11
which is not what I'd expect (although it has some sense).
Is it a bug (worth (re)reporting)? Is it already solved? I'm using povray
3.6.1
